    <title>2026 (9) TMI 256 - ITAT RAJKOT</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/caselaws?id=798230</link>
    <description>Independent application of mind is required for sanction under Section 151; a bare &quot;Approved&quot; endorsement without examination of material or satisfaction on reopening is mechanically granted and invalid. Reassessment based on cash deposits in jointly held bank accounts also requires recorded reasons establishing a live nexus between the assessee and income escaping assessment. Where the assessee is only the second account holder, no material links the entire deposits to taxable income, and agricultural activity supports the explanation, the reopening lacks jurisdiction. The reassessment and consequential additions are unsustainable.</description>
